Zoltan Fecso + Claire Lefebvre Album Launch Live Performance and Art Exhibition

  • Floreo Creative Project Space 1-3 Nelson Street Apollo Bay, VIC, 3233 Australia (map)

Zoltan Fecso + Claire Lefevbre will be presenting an immersive creative evening of incredible sound performance and paintings inspired by the local area. Profits go towards The Development Lab Artist Residency Programs.

Zoltan Fecso Performance

Zoltan Fecso has performed and presented work in festivals, venues and galleries in Australia and Europe. 'Valley' was written & recorded in Apollo Bay on Gadubanud Country, during The Development Lab/ Winter Wild - Artist in Residence program in August 2021.

↓ THE ART ↓

"This series responds to memories of moments in nature from the Winter Wild Artist Residency in 2021. In creating these paintings I relied on the precariousness of memory to create form, colour and composition. I'm interested in what elements of memory remain and what disappears as time passes, and what that says about ourselves and our experience of the natural world."

↓ THE BIOS ↓

Zoltan Fecso is a musician and composer based on Wurundjeri Land in Naarm/ Melbourne. Using limitations as a discipline, Zoltan’s interdisciplinary approach to sound explores the experiences of active listening.

Zoltan's music can be found on Hush Hush Records (USA) The Slow Music Movement (PT), Shimmering Moods (NL) and Whitelab Records (UK). He has performed and presented work in festivals, venues and galleries in Australia and Europe, including the Melbourne Recital Centre, Jolt Sonic Arts Festival, STEIM Amsterdam, Jan Herman Ridderbos Gallery in France and FestivALT in Poland.

Claire Lefebvre lives and works on Wurundjeri Land in Naarm/ Melbourne, Australia and in 2014 completed a Master of Fine Arts, with Distinction. Her five solo shows in Melbourne include "Lush Layer Light" at ODCE (2018), "Awe Is What Moves Us Forward" at Alternating Current Art Space (2017), "United States of Curiosity" at Red Gallery (2016), "Luminous Numinous" at Tinning Street Presents (2016) and "New Work" at Side Car Gallery (2013). Her numerous group exhibitions include "Red Stocking" (Red Gallery, 2016), “For the Love of Colour” (Gallerysmith Project Space, 2015) and “Real Delirium” (N/A Gallery, 2014). Claire was shortlisted for the M Collection Prize and won the RMIT MFA Alumni Prize in 2014, was named a finalist in both the Albany Art Prize and the Hornsby Art Prize in 2015 and was shortlisted for the St Kevin's Art Show in 2019. Her work is held in several private collections in Australia, Europe and the UK.

Claire's practice is influenced by wonderment and a deep reciprocal relationship with the natural world. She works across painting, drawing, sculpture, tattooing, knitting and storytelling.
